Common HotelDash.exe Errors on Windows

Confronting errors linked to HotelDash.exe can be a daunting task due to the diversity of underlying causes, which might include software incompatibility, obsolete drivers, or even malware presence. In the section below, we've enumerated the most frequently encountered errors related to HotelDash.exe in order to assist you in comprehending and potentially rectifying the issues.

  •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): Although not strictly an HotelDash.exe error, certain .exe files can cause system instability leading to a BSOD, indicating a fatal system error.
  • Access is Denied: This error usually comes up due to permission issues. It indicates that the user does not have the necessary rights to execute a certain .exe file.
  • HotelDash.exe Application Error: This warning appears when the executable application faces a difficulty during its operation. This could be brought about by software errors, damaged associated files, or clashes with other running programs.
  •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This alert appears when the application cannot initiate correctly, often resulting from a mismatch between the Windows version and the application regarding 32-bit and 64-bit configurations.
  • Error 0xc0000005: This warning appears when the system encounters an access violation problem. This could be due to issues with memory, malware affecting the system, or drivers that need updating.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the HotelDash.exe Error

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run SFC Scan

Step 2: Run SFC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type sfc /scannow and press Enter.

  2.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ors Thumbnail
  1. Review the scan results once completed.

  2. Follow the on-screen instructions to repair any errors found.
